Beyond the translation

Song interpretation

This energetic song from Vetri Vizha celebrates youth, romance, freedom, and dynamic rhythm. Written with classic Vaali wordplay, the lyrics blend classical dance rhythm syllables ('solkattu') with themes of passionate love and unrestrained freedom. The protagonists describe a playful, electric closeness where touch is felt even without physical contact, comparing their dynamic spirit to wild deer, free birds breaking out of cages, and unstoppable floods of music. The song captures a sense of joyful triumph, freedom, and youthful exuberance.

Writing craft

Poetic devices

Paradox / Oxymoron (Muran)

Thottom thodaamal thottom

The phrase 'Thottom thodaamal thottom' (Touched without touching) and 'Pattum padaamal pattom' express a poetic contradiction describing subtle, non-physical sensory intimacy.

Edukai (Second-letter Rhyme)

Iravil unnodu narthanamthaan / Uravil munnooru keerthanamthaan

Rhyming of the second letter 'ra' in consecutive lines ('Iravil' and 'Uravil') creates auditory harmony.

Monai (First-letter Alliteration)

Inaiyathan inaiyathan / Anaiyathan anaiyathan

Alliteration of the initial letter 'I' across 'Inaiyathan' and 'Anaiyathan' or 'Iravil' and 'Idaiyil'.

Adukku Thodar (Repetitive Emphasis)

Thazhuvattum thazhuvattum / Ilavattam ilavattam

Words are repeated consecutively for emphasis and musical cadence (e.g., 'Thazhuvattum thazhuvattum', 'Ilavattam ilavattam').
